ICD-10-CMThis code indicates that a patient has sustained a bite from a mammal other than a cat, dog, rat, or human, and they are presenting for follow-up care related to this injury. This includes conditions such as wound checks, dressing changes, or evaluation of infection after the initial treatment.
Use this code for subsequent encounters when a patient returns for ongoing management of a bite wound inflicted by an animal like a squirrel, rabbit, raccoon, or any other unspecified mammal. This applies after the initial treatment has been rendered and the patient is no longer in the acute phase of care.
